To replace the battery:

0

1. Open the transmitter case using a flat-

head screwdriver.

2. Remove the old battery from the hold-

er.

1) Negative (–) side facing up

3. Replace with a new battery (Type

CR2025 or equivalent) making sure to in-

stall the new battery with the negative (–)

side facing up.

4. Refit the removed half of the transmit-

ter case.

After the battery is replaced, the trans-

mitter must be synchronized with the

keyless entry system’s control unit.

Press either the “

” or “

” button

six times to synchronize the unit.

Replacing lost transmitters

If you lose a transmitter or want to pur-

chase additional transmitters (up to four

can be programmed), you should re-pro-

gram all of your transmitters for security

reasons. It is recommended that you have

your dealer program all of your transmit-

ters into your system.

T Programming the transmitters
The keyless entry system is equipped with

a special code learning feature that allows

you to program new transmitter codes into

the system or to delete old ones. The sys-

tem can learn up to four unique transmitter

codes. The four transmitter codes may be

the same or different.
